The Town of Wolfville is inviting people to joint staff, Council and consultants at the Market to discuss planning for Wolfville’s
future. The Town is reviewing its planning documents and wants your
input. This will be a casual, conversational event that is perfect for
those who don’t wish to participate in workshops or use our on-line
tools. Provide input to this important process
and support the market vendors at the same time by purchasing your
supper and sitting down with us to talk in a designated area in the Community Room of the Market. After supper, those who wish
can walk over the Whittle Theatre for a formal workshop on a variety of
planning issues.
